Predictive Estimation Techniques for Vibrating Screen Performance Optimization
Vibrating screens are an essential part of many industrial processes, used to separate particles of different sizes or materials. The efficiency and performance of a vibrating screen directly impact the overall productivity of a production line. To optimize the performance of these screens, the use of predictive estimation techniques has become increasingly important.
Predictive estimation techniques provide valuable insights into the behavior and performance of vibrating screens, allowing for early identification of potential issues and the implementation of proactive measures to prevent them. By analyzing real-time data from vibrating screens, predictive models can be built to estimate parameters such as screening efficiency, flow rate, and particle size distribution.
One commonly used predictive estimation technique for vibrating screens is the discrete element method (DEM). This technique simulates the behavior of individual particles as they interact with the screen surface, considering factors such as particle shape, size, and material properties. By running DEM simulations, engineers can assess the impact of different operating parameters, such as screen inclination, frequency, and amplitude, on the screening efficiency and overall performance.
Another widely used technique is finite element analysis (FEA), which allows for the prediction of structural behavior and stress distribution in vibrating screens. By modeling the screen structure and applying appropriate loads, FEA can identify potential weaknesses or areas of high stress that may affect the screen's performance. This information can then be used to optimize the screen's design or operating parameters.
Predictive estimation techniques are also key in the development of advanced control strategies for vibrating screens. By combining real-time data from sensors with predictive models, feedback control systems can be implemented to dynamically adjust operating parameters and optimize screen performance. These systems can be designed to detect abnormal behavior, such as screen blinding or excess material buildup, and take corrective actions automatically.
